by Christopher Durang - Directed by 2012 guest artist, Danny Mitarotando

Contemporary New York playwright Christopher Durang turns political humor upside down with this raucous and provocative Bush-era satire about America’s growing homeland “insecurity.”

A Marx-Brotherish political cartoon of a play, Why Torture is Wrong and The People Who Love Them tells the story of a young woman suddenly in crisis: Is her new husband, whom she married when drunk,
a terrorist? Is her father’s hobby of butterfly collecting really a cover for his involvement in a shadow government?

Honing in on our private terrors both at home and abroad, Durang oddly relieves our fears in this black comedy for an era of yellow, orange and red alerts.
